Budget-Friendly Hearing Aids: Options for Every Budget

Hearing loss impacts millions of people worldwide, and the cost of hearing aids can be a primary barrier to treatment. Luckily, there are now many inexpensive options available that make hearing healthier more accessible.

Whether you're on a tight budget or simply looking for value, consider the following choices:

* Over-the-shelf hearing aids are becoming increasingly popular due to their simplicity. These devices can be purchased directly from pharmacies without a prescription.

Used or refurbished hearing aids can offer significant savings compared to acquiring new ones. Be sure to buy from a reliable source and have the devices inspected by an audiologist before use.

*

Many insurance plans now cover at least some of the cost of hearing aids. Contact your insurance provider to find out what your benefits are.

Non-profit organizations such as the Sertoma International may offer financial assistance programs or savings on hearing aids.

Where to Acquire Hearing Aids: Navigating Your Choices

Hearing loss is a common condition that can affect people of all ages. If you're experiencing hearing difficulties, it's important to seek professional help. One essential step in managing your hearing loss is finding the right hearing aids. There are many different options available, and choosing the best pair for you can be overwhelming. This article will guide you through the process of where to acquire hearing aids.

Your journey might begin at your family physician's office. They can perform a basic hearing test and suggest you to an audiologist for a more comprehensive evaluation. Audiologists are specialists who identify hearing impairments and suggest the most suitable hearing aids based on your individual needs.

  • You can also contact a local hearing center or specialist clinic. These facilities often have experienced audiologists who can provide you with expert advice and fitting services.
  • In recent years, the availability of hearing aids remotely has grown. Many reputable stores now offer a comprehensive selection of hearing aids directly to consumers.

It's important to remember that choosing hearing aids is a individual decision. What works best for one person may not be the ideal solution for another. Take your time, research your alternatives, and consult qualified professionals to confirm you find the hearing aids that appropriately meet your expectations.

Hearing aids

Choosing the best spot to buy hearing aids can feel overwhelming, but it doesn't have to be. Starting with, consider your needs. Do you need basic amplification or advanced capabilities? After that, think about your financial plan and the variety of hearing aids that fit your lifestyle.

  • Hearing aid specialists are a great starting point, offering personalized recommendations.
  • Online retailers can be accessible, but ensure you choose a reputable source with transparent return policies.
  • Local hearing aid dispensaries allow for in-person tests and ongoing help.

Remember to research your choices carefully and inquire about warranties, financing, and after-sales service. By taking the time to shop around, you can find the perfect hearing aids for your unique needs and budget.
